Kathryn Sulloway Adams Andrea Moore Mary Rita Roux‐Zink L. Michael Wykes Lynn Kearny 《Performance Improvement》2015,54(9):12-18
Do you regularly reflect on the value you bring to your client? The act of reflection is something experienced consultants, both internal and external, consistently do in their practice. This article examines the ways in which Certified Performance Technologists (CPTs) define and recognize the success of their efforts, but most importantly, how they learn from engagements that do not always end with the desired outcome. You will hear from CPTs across several industries in their own words about what strategies they have employed to continue to improve their skill sets. 相似文献

Muruvvet Demiral‐Uzan 《Performance Improvement Quarterly》2015,28(3):7-23
This case study examines the design practices of instructional design (ID) students while working on a realistic design project (Joel, 1987) to explore whether ID students make design judgments; how, when, and where they are making them; and what kinds of judgments they make during a realistic instructional design process. The perspective taken in this study is that design judgments comprise multiple, complex types and are not confined to moments of overt decision making (Nelson & Stolterman, 2012). In this small‐scale case study, a group of students was observed in the process of designing instruction within a semester. The findings of the study suggest that these ID students continuously made design judgments of many kinds throughout the design process. 相似文献

The aim of this study was to compare optimization and correction procedures for the determination of peak power output during friction-loaded cycle ergometry. Ten male and 10 female sports students each performed five 10-s sprints from a stationary start on a Monark 864 basket-loaded ergometer. Resistive loads of 5.0, 6.5, 8.0, 9.5, and 11.0% body weight were administered in a counterbalanced order, with a recovery period of 10 min between sprints. Peak power was greater and occurred earlier, with less work having been done before the attainment of peak power, when the data were corrected to account for the inertial and frictional characteristics of the ergometer. Corrected peak power was independent of resistive load (P > 0.05), whereas uncorrected peak power varied as a quadratic function of load (P < 0.001). For males and females, optimized peak power (971 +/- 122 and 668 +/- 37 W) was lower (P < 0.01) than either the highest (1074 +/- 111 and 754 +/- 56 W respectively) or the mean (1007 +/- 125 and 701 +/- 45 W respectively) of the five values for corrected peak power. Optimized and mean corrected peak power were highly correlated both in males (r = 0.97, P < 0.001) and females (r = 0.96, P < 0.001). The difference between optimized and mean corrected peak power was 37 +/- 30 W in males and 33 +/- 14 W in females, of which approximately 15 W was due to the correction for frictional losses. We conclude that corrected peak power is independent of resistive load in males and females. 相似文献

Traditionally, it has been assumed that during middle-distance running oxygen uptake (VO2) reaches its maximal value (VO2max) providing the event is of a sufficient duration; however, this assumption is largely based on observations in individuals with a relatively low VO2max. The aim of this study was to determine whether VO2max is related to the VO2 attained (i.e. VO2peak) during middle-distance running on a treadmill. Fifteen well-trained male runners (age 23.3 +/- 3.8 years, height 1.80 +/- 0.10 m, body mass 76.9 +/- 10.6 kg) volunteered to participate in the study. The participants undertook two 800-m trials to examine the reproducibility of the VO2 response. These two trials, together with a progressive test to determine VO2max, were completed in a randomized order. Oxygen uptake was determined throughout each test using 15-s Douglas bag collections. Following the application of a 30-s rolling average, the highest VO2 during the progressive test (i.e. VO2max) was compared with the highest VO2 during the 800-m trials (i.e. VO2peak) to examine the relationship between VO2max and the VO2 attained in the 800-m trials. For the 15 runners, VO2max was 58.9 +/- 7.1 ml x kg(-1) x min(-1). Two groups were formed using a median split based on VO2max. For the high and low VO2max groups, VO2max was 65.7 +/- 3.0 and 52.4 +/- 1.8 ml x kg(-1) x min(-1) respectively. The limits of agreement (95%) for test-retest reproducibility for the VO2 attained during the 800-m trials were +/- 3.5 ml x kg(-1) x min(-1) for a VO2peak of 50.6 ml x kg(-1) x min(-1) (the mean VO2peak for the low VO2max group) and +/- 2.3 ml x kg(-1) x min(-1) for a VO2peak of 59.0 ml x kg(-1) x min(-1) (the mean VO2peak for the high VO2max group), with a bias in VO2peak between the 800-m runs (i.e. the mean difference) of 1.2 ml x kg(-1) x min(-1). The VO2peak for the 800-m runs was 54.8 +/- 4.9 ml x kg(-1) x min(-1) for all 15 runners. For the high and low VO2max groups, VO2peak was 59.0 +/- 3.3 ml x kg(-1) x min(-1) (i.e. 90% VO2max) and 50.6 +/- 2.0 ml x kg(-1) x min(-1) (i.e. 97% VO2max) respectively. The negative relationship (-0.77) between VO2max and % VO2max attained for all 15 runners was significant (P = 0.001). These results demonstrate that (i) reproducibility is good and (ii) that VO2max is related to the %VO2max achieved, with participants with a higher VO2max achieving a lower %VO2max in an 800-m trial on a treadmill. 相似文献

Joseph Trovato John Harris Colin W. Pryor S. Cynthia Wilkinson 《Psychology in the schools》1992,29(1):52-61
An operant-based program was established to study the effectiveness of regular classroom teachers as mediators for behavior change in regular classroom settings. Fifty-nine first and second graders were matched on several measures and randomly assigned to an experimental condition or a control condition. Experimental children were addressed through teacher-generatedlconsultant-supported behavior intervention strategies. Changes in behavior were examined by assessing differences from initial baseline and from first to second administration of the Child Behavior Checklist. In- class behavior change was significantly greater for the experimental condition than for the control condition, although behavior change from first to second administration of the Child Behavior Checklist was significant for all groups. A moderate to high rate of compliance to the intervention program was maintained by teachers, and moderate to high ratings of satisfaction were obtained for the program from all participants. The effectiveness, feasibility, and applicability of the program are discussed. 相似文献
